WebEucalyptus camaldulensis, commonly known as the river red gum, [3] is a tree that is endemic to Australia. It has smooth white or cream-coloured bark, lance-shaped or curved adult leaves, flower buds in groups of seven or nine, white flowers and hemispherical fruit with the valves extending beyond the rim. WebGum Swamp Reserve. Gum Swamp Reserve, a high conservation River Red gum wetland is located 2kms north of Walla Walla. The size and diversity of plants and trees at the Swamp provide many opportunities for wildlife. When the Gum Swamp fills, many birds use it for breeding and foraging. 150 species of birds have been identified; these include the ... WebThe River Red Gum swamp woodland contains fabulous original old large hollow-bearing trees, ringed by regrowth with various sedges, rushes and grasses. When the swamp fills, four years out of ten, there are a variety of aquatic plants such as nardoo and water ribbons. Once full it usually retains some water throughout the summer.
